Output 70517079534013df8226fe99c9934a84a720f8e9a554e92679a945a4f1665da4:1

value
303660
script pubkey
OP_0 OP_PUSHBYTES_20 2cf5a4e105501083d23e9471a3b9128ebf558fb3
address
bc1q9n66fcg92qgg8537j3c68wgj36l4trancg0jg4
transaction
70517079534013df8226fe99c9934a84a720f8e9a554e92679a945a4f1665da4
confirmations
98286
spent
true